			<description><![CDATA[<p>I love the fact that you can pin your blogs with Internet Explorer 9, but there are few...problems that arise when using Internet Explorer.<br />
I'm not sure if this is only with WordPress.com or with self-hosted blog, but I noticed that dragging and dropping does not work in IE, unless you enable Compatibility Mode. This most likely means the blog is feeding IE users different code. I'd suggest using different code for IE9 users, as using Compatibility Mode messes up other parts of the blog/site, such as the top bar and any rounded elements.<br />
